Mass Celebrated at San Gottardo Pass Draws 1,500 Pilgrims
On 1 August 2026, a Catholic Mass was held at the San Gottardo Pass to mark Switzerland’s National Day. The celebration was presided over by Monsignor Alain de Raemy, apostolic administrator of the Diocese of Lugano, and co‑celebrated by Bishops Jean‑Marie Lovey, Joseph Maria Bonnemain and emeritus prelates.
Around 1,500 faithful ascended to the 2,100‑metre altitude, some arriving on a special train and organized buses, while a group walked from Motto Bartola beginning at 07:30. The event was produced by Bruno Boccaletti for RSI and was broadcast live on RSI, with retransmissions on SRF and RTS.
Weather was mixed, with wind and sunshine giving way to clouds and a chill near the end. Attendees wore red patriotic caps, including a notable one worn by Swiss President Guy Parmelin, evoking the iconic MAGA hat. The liturgy featured the diocesan choir, a brass quartet, and Alpine horn players, creating a solemn atmosphere amid the mountain scenery.
